The Las Vegas Raiders have had quite the offseason so far. They traded for quarterback Geno Smith, hired Pete Carroll as their head coach, and made a splash in the draft by taking Boise State running back Ashton Jeanty at No. 6 overall.
As they look ahead to training camp, there are still a few under-the-radar pieces of business, namely an extension for cornerstone left tackle Kolton Miller.
